Colchester United and Stevenage draw 1-1 on Saturday. HIGHLIGHTS

COLCHESTER. Colchester United and Stevenage draw 1-1. M. Marshall scored the first goal (6′) for Colchester United. D. Rose settled the score (17′).

The match was played at the JobServe Community Stadium stadium in Colchester on Saturday and it started at 3:00 pm local time. The referee was Ben Speedie with the support of Damith Bandara and Leigh Crowhurst. The 4th official was Craig Hicks. The weather was cloudy. The temperature was pleasant at 19.4 degrees Celsius or 66.85 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 80%.​

Ball possession

There was not much difference in terms of ball possession. Colchester United was in possession of the ball for 48% of the time vs. Stevenage that controlled the ball for 52% of the time.

Attitude and shots

Stevenage had a more offensive attitude with 60 dangerous attacks and 18 shots of which 5 were on target. However, that was not enough Stevenage to win the match​.

Colchester United shot 5 times, 1 on target, 4 off target. Regarding the opposition, Stevenage shot 18 times, 5 on target, 13 off target.

Cards

Colchester United received 1 yellow card (M. Marshall). On the opposite side, Stevenage received 3 yellow cards (C. Piergianni, L. Wildin and S. Earley).

Standings

After this match, Colchester United will have 11 points to hold in the 24th place. Talking about the opposition, Stevenage will have 36 points to remain in the 2nd place.

Next matches

In the next match in the League Two, Colchester United will play away with Crawley Town on the 18th of April with a 9-4 head to head in favor of Crawley Town (7 draws).

Stevenage will host Doncaster Rovers on the 18th of April with a 3-2 head to head in favor of Doncaster Rovers (1 draw).
